Ukraine's inflation rate edged up 1.1 percent in September
October 07, 2008 at 16:04 | Ukrainian NewsIn September, food and soft drinks prices increased by 0.3 percent, public and housing utilities costs grew by nearly four percent, health care services prices rose a percentage point and transport cost fell by 1.1 percent.
For the firstnine months of 2008, the nation's inflation rate stands at 16.1 percent.
In June, Ukraine’s Cabinet of Ministers adjusted their annual inflation rate forecast from 9.6 percent to 15.3 percent.
